World Environment Day 2021: Theme, ‘Ecosystem Restoration’ Significance and History
World Environment Day (WED) is celebrated annually on 5 June and is the United Nations’ principal vehicle for encouraging awareness and action for the protection of the environment.
First held in 1974, it has been a platform for raising awareness on environmental issue such as marine pollution, human overpopulation, global warming, sustainable consumption and wildlife crime.
World Environment Day is a global platform for public outreach, with participation from over 143 countries annually. Each year, the program has provided a theme and forum for businesses, non government organizations, communities, governments and celebrities to advocate environmental causes.

Which country will host the World Environment Day 2021?
Pakistan
Host for this year
Pakistan will host World Environment Day 2021 in collaboration with the UN Environment Programme (UNEP)

How did World Environment Day start?
World Environment Day was established in 1972 by the United Nations at the Stockholm Conference on the Human Environment, that had resulted from discussions on the integration of human interactions and the environment. Two years later, in 1974 the first WED was held with the theme “Only One Earth”. Even though WED celebration have been held annually since 1974, in 1987 the idea for rotating the center of these activities through selecting different host countries began.
What is the theme for World Environment Day 2021?
World Environment Day theme 2021
The theme of this year’s World Environment Day is ‘Reimagine. Recreate. Restore.‘ as this year marks the beginning of the United Nations Decade on Ecosystem Restoration.
What is the theme of World Environment Day 2020?
The theme for World Environment Day 2020 is, ‘Time for Nature,’ with a focus on its role in providing the essential infrastructure that supports life on Earth and human development.
